Синтез структуры вычислительной системы оперативной обработки данных

Автор работы: Пользователь скрыл имя, 29 Апреля 2013 в 08:36, лабораторная работа

Описание

Пусть синтезируемая система предназначена для решения задач, интенсивность поступления которых l0=0,18 c-1. Система содержит процессор, сетевые адаптеры и внешние запоминающие устройства (ВЗУ). Предполагается, что в качестве устройств внешней памяти системы используются НГМД и НМЛ (стримеры). Нагрузка на систему от поступивших задач определяется средней трудоемкостью процессорных операций q=1,16 оп. и средним числом обращений N к внешним запоминающим устройствам. Распределение обращений к ВЗУ различных типов задается значениями N1=54, N2=9 для НГМД и НМЛ соответственно, причем N=N1+N2.

Работа состоит из  1 файл

LAB4_help.doc

— 166.50 Кб (Скачать документ)


 Синтез структуры

вычислительной системы  оперативной обработки данных

Пусть синтезируемая  система предназначена для решения  задач, интенсивность поступления которых l0=0,18 c-1. Система содержит процессор, сетевые адаптеры и внешние запоминающие устройства (ВЗУ). Предполагается, что в качестве устройств внешней памяти системы используются НГМД и НМЛ (стримеры). Нагрузка на систему от поступивших задач определяется средней трудоемкостью процессорных операций q=1,16 оп. и средним числом обращений N к внешним запоминающим устройствам. Распределение обращений к ВЗУ различных типов задается значениями N1=54, N2=9 для НГМД и НМЛ соответственно, причем N=N1+N2. Средние времена доступа к информации для этих типов накопителей равны соответственно tНГМД=0,11 с, tНМЛ=3 с. Кроме того, к известным параметрам СООД относятся скорость передачи данных через сетевые адаптеры  VСА=118 Кбайт/с и трудоемкость операций обмена с ВЗУ qоб=28 Кбайт, определяемая средним объемом информации, передаваемой при одном обращении к ВЗУ. Коэффициент стоимости процессора системы равен k1=1 , т.е. стоимость быстродействия одной операций в секунду равна одному рублю. Стоимость типовых устройств системы равна: SНГМД=49 тыс. р., SНМЛ=25 тыс. р., SСА=61 тыс. р.

В примере рассмотрены два варианта решения задачи синтеза систем оперативной обработки данных: 1) синтез СООД заданной стоимости на заданном множестве устройств и 2) синтез СООД с заданным временем ответа на заданном множестве устройств.

При решении задачи в  первой постановке стоимость синтезируемой системы не должна превышать S*=867 тыс. р. и время ответа должно быть минимальным.

При решении задачи во второй постановке среднее время  ответа системы не должно превосходить заданной величины U*=75 с, причем стоимость системы должна быть минимальной.

Минимальная конфигурация СООД определяется для обеих постановок задач одинаково.

 

Определение минимальной  конфигурации

системы оперативной  обработки данных

Модель синтезируемой  системы соответствует разомкнутой  стохастической сети. Для этой модели определим коэффициенты передач a1-a4 и интенсивности потоков заявок l1-l4 для процессора, НГМД, НМЛ и сетевых адаптеров соответственно. Из физического смысла коэффициентов передач следует, что

a2=N1=54;

a3=N2=9;

a4=N1+N2=63;

a1=N1+N2+1=64;

l1=a1´l0=11,52 с-1;

l2=a2´l0=9,72 с-1;

l3=a3´l0=1,62 с-1;

l4=a4´l0=11,34 с-1.


Средняя трудоемкость операций счета в процессоре составляет 

q1=q/a1=17187,5 операций.

Среднее время обращения  к ВЗУ и среднее время передачи данных через сетевые адаптеры равно соответственно

J2=tНГМД=0,11 c; J3=tНМЛ=3 c;

J4=qоб/VСА=0,23729 c.


Решение задачи синтеза  сводится теперь к определению числа  НГМД (K2), НМЛ (K3), числа сетевых адаптеров (K4) и быстродействия процессора V1.

Минимальное быстродействие процессора определяется из условия существования стационарного режима (4.4)

V1min=l1´q1=l0´q=198000»200000 оп/с.

Минимальное число  остальных устройств системы определяется из того же условия (4.5) Kimin=li´Ji

K2min=l2´J2=2;

K3min=l3´J3=5;

K4min=l4´J4=3.


Стоимость минимальной  конфигурации системы в рублях равна (4.6)

 

Решение задачи синтеза системы оперативной  обработки данных

заданной стоимости  на заданном множестве устройств

Для решения этой задачи необходимо определить избыточную стоимость  системы (4.7)

S0=S*-Smin=263000 р.

Произведем распределение  избыточной стоимости по устройствам  системы в соответствии с (4.8) и (4.9)

;

;

.

После округления эти  параметры имеют значения

V1=254000оп/с;

K2=2;

K3=9;

K4=5.


Округление идет до ближайшего целого не меньшего li´Ji.

Для полученной системы, состоящей из процессора с быстродействием  254000 оп/c, двух НГМД, девяти НМЛ и пяти сетевых адаптеров, определим по (4.2) среднее время ответа системы U и по (4.10) стоимость системы S в рублях

;

.

Таким образом, при решении  первой задачи синтеза СООД получена оптимальная конфигурация системы, среднее время ответа для которой равно 142,3513 с и стоимость (881341 рублей) превышает заданное  значение в 867000 рублей.

 

Решение задачи синтеза системы оперативной  обработки данных

с заданным временем ответа на заданном множестве устройств

Для минимальной конфигурации системы резерв времени (4.14) составляет

Определим оптимальные параметры системы в соответствии с (4.12) и (4.13)

;

;

;

.

После округления эти  параметры имеют значения K2 = 4; K3 = 19; K4 = 8. Округление идет до ближайшего целого, не меньшего li´Ji.

Быстродействие системы  с такими параметрами равно (4.2)

,

что указывает на наличие некоторого запаса быстродействия. Стоимость синтезируемой системы (4.10)

можно уменьшить. Для  этого оставшееся время (4.15)

распределяется на процессор. В связи с этим скорость процессора может быть уменьшена до величины (4.16)

.

Стоимость системы в этом случае также снизится

,

а время ответа равно  предельному значению

.

Таким образом, оптимальная  конфигурация системы равна: один процессор, четыре НГМД, девятнадцать НМЛ и восемь сетевых адаптеров. Среднее время ответа системы – 75 с при ее стоимости в рублях 1493019,3755 р.

 

В данной работе стоимостные  характеристики и параметры быстродействия отличаются от реальных и выбраны такими для наглядности расчетов.

 

 

 

Графики

 

 

 


Информация о работе Синтез структуры вычислительной системы оперативной обработки данных